    Hi

     

    Apple's Standard Return Policy is 14 days.

     

    If you purchased your watch directly from Apple, you would need to ask Apple they will make an exception in your case. Either contact the Apple Retail Store or call Apple Online Store.

     

    Contact details for the US, for example, are here: http://www.apple.com/contact/

     

    I'm afraid that no-one here can you what Apple will decide - this is a user-based community.

     

    Apple Watch is not presently included under Apple's trade-in / recycling program.

     

    If you are unable to return it, you may therefore wish to consider either keeping it or selling your watch privately and putting the proceeds towards buying a new model.
